A little misleading to say the Aesops' Fable 'inspired' Disney... 'reassured' might be closer. He saw it when in New York looking for a company to record the soundtrack for "Steamboat Wilie", and wrote back to his brother Roy: “It merely had an orchestra playing and adding some noises. The talking part does not mean a thing. It doesn’t even match. We sure have nothing to worry about from these quarters”.
